Eligibility Requirements
Victims of federally declared disasters
- 1Federally declared disaster area
- 2Loss exceeds 10% of AGI minus $100
- 3Insurance claim filed
Virginia residents should verify that this deduction is also recognized on their state tax return for additional savings of up to 5.75%.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
- !Not filing insurance claim first
- !Including losses outside disaster area
- !Forgetting to claim the deduction on your Virginia state return (missing 5.75% additional savings)

What tax forms do I need to claim the Casualty and Theft Loss (Federal Disaster) in Virginia?
To claim the casualty and theft loss (federal disaster), you need to file Form 4684 and Schedule A with your federal return. Virginia residents should also check if the state allows this deduction on their state return, which could provide an additional 5.75% savings.
